Women's Rugby Backs Coach

As Women’s Rugby Backs Coach you will provide specialist coaching expertise to the Women’s Rugby performance programme with a primary focus on developing the backs unit, enhancing attacking and defensive backfield performance, and contributing to the competitive success of the Women’s 1st XV in BUCS Super Rugby and associated competitions. The coach will also support the broader performance group to provide specialist knowledge and work with players across the performance and development environments.

You’ll play a key role in: 

  • Backs Unit Leadership - Lead the technical and tactical development of the backs unit, including passing, handling, decision-making, kicking, counter-attack, defensive systems, and backfield organisation. Integrate these technical components within the team's overall game model to ensure clarity of role, decision-making, and contribution to team strategy.
  • Training session delivery.
  • Match preparation and support.
  • Talent identification and recruitment support.


What you’ll bring 

  • Expert technical understanding of backs play including enhancing attacking and defensive backfield performance.
  • Strong track record in planning and delivering structured, periodised training sessions.
  • Ability to translate tactical concepts into practical coaching that improves performance.
